How they compare
Ecuador currently reports 321,761 against 160,517 in Dominican Republic, a difference of 161,244.
That makes Ecuador's figure about 2.0 times Dominican Republic's.
Across all 8 years both countries report, Ecuador has been ahead every year.
Dominican Republic ranks 28th and Ecuador ranks 25th of 40 countries.
Ecuador has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
